Hi, I'm Miguel Navarro, chilean, i live in Buenos Aires since 2015, where i came to specialize myself as tango guitar player. Before I had done classical music studies in Chile.
I consider myself a restless, passionate about music and guitar. I have been interested in different music such as Latin-American folklore and jazz manouche.
I've always been teaching, one of the things I like the most is being able to share with musicians, both amateurs and professionals, and learn from the richness of those encounters.
In my classes I try to mainly deal with 3 axes: technique, theory and interpretation. Three axes that I consider very important for the development of any musician. Then if the student has specific interests about something, of course it is modified / incorporated to the classes and it is worked.
I also offer classes in music theory, improvisation, arrangements, solfege, harmony, audio-perceptive.
